A serene Early Renaissance panel by Piero della Francesca, depicting Saint Jerome in the wilderness with a kneeling donor.
This work by Piero della Francesca depicts Saint Jerome in the wilderness, engaged in his scholarly pursuits. The saint sits upon a stone bench, his gaze directed toward a kneeling donor who presents himself in prayer. The composition is defined by the artist's characteristic interest in geometric clarity and mathematical perspective. The figures occupy a space that feels both grounded and removed from the world, a hallmark of the artist's approach to religious narrative.
The background features a distant townscape, rendered with a precision that suggests the influence of Northern European painting techniques on the Italian Renaissance. The light is cool and even, casting soft shadows that define the forms of the figures and the surrounding terrain. A large tree provides a vertical anchor to the right, balancing the presence of the crucifix on the left. The donor, dressed in a simple red robe, provides a stark contrast to the ascetic, semi-nude figure of the saint.
Piero della Francesca was a master of light and volume. His ability to integrate human figures into a coherent, measured space is evident here. The painting avoids excessive ornamentation, focusing instead on the psychological interaction between the saint and the supplicant. The inscription on the base of the crucifix identifies the donor as Girolamo Amadi, a Venetian merchant. This work remains a clear example of the artist's ability to balance theological subject matter with a rigorous, almost scientific, observation of the physical world. The muted palette of earth tones, punctuated by the deep red of the donor's garment, creates a sense of quiet contemplation suitable for a private devotional object.
